General Elections in Spain 2016

MADRID, SPAIN - JUNE 26: A Unidos Podemos (United We Can) supporter holds a flag reading 'United We Can' as party members stand on stage after learning the elections results on June 26, 2016 in Madrid, Spain. Spanish voters head back to the polls after the last election in December failed to produce a government. Latest opinion polls suggest the Unidos Podemos left-wing alliance could make enough gains to come in second behind the ruling center right Popular Party.
